For those looking for a job in Central Texas, the Belton Independent School District is set to host a job fair, and relatively soon.

Belton ISD Job Fair Set For January 20th

According to a press release from the district, the fair will be located at 1220 Huey Dr. in Belton, and take place at the Support Services Center for the district. Positions that will be available for interviews will be nutrition services staff, bus drivers, custodians, and groundkeepers.

In a comment provided by the Assistant Superintendent for Human Resources, Todd Schiller: “Belton ISD has something really special to offer those interested in a career in education, at any level, We are proud to have a culture that supports and values every member of our team. For that reason, folks want to work in the Big Red Community."
